About the role

 

Ready to shape the future of online meals? As our Technology Lead, you’ll be the driving force behind the QuiteLike subscription business, leading the end-to-end technology strategy and delivery. From cloud infrastructure and software engineering to data, analytics, and cyber security, you’ll make sure everything runs smoothly, securely, and at scale. Your work will power customer-centric solutions that could integrate seamlessly with Coles Online platforms and enable growth for one of the most exciting parts of our business.

 

This role reports to the Head of QuiteLike and is based in Melbourne. You’ll collaborate with a wide range of stakeholders - from product and operations teams to external tech partners - making every day different and full of impact.

 

 

About you and your skills

 

You’re a tech leader who loves turning big ideas into reality. With a strong background in architecture, engineering, and delivery, you know how to build scalable systems and lead high-performing teams. You thrive in fast-paced, agile environments and have a knack for aligning technology with business goals. 

 

 

You’ll also bring:

 

  • 10+ years in technology leadership roles, ideally in eCommerce or subscription-based businesses
  • Expertise in cloud infrastructure, SaaS solutions, and vendor management
  • Solid experience in cyber security, compliance, and data governance
  • A commercial mindset - you understand budgets, strategy, and how tech drives growth
  • Strong communication and stakeholder engagement skills
  • A passion for building teams and fostering a culture of innovation
